| Product Name | ABS YOUHER1385P |
| Brand | YOUHER |
| Model Number | 1385P |
| Material | Acrylonitrile Butadiene Styrene (ABS) |
| Color | Black |
| Weight | 25 kg |
| Form | Pellets |
| Application | Injection Molding |
| Density | 1.04 g/cm3 |
| Melt Flow Index | 18 g/10min |
| Tensile Strength | 40 MPa |
| Impact Strength | 15 kJ/m2 |
| Heat Deflection Temperature | 90°C |
| Country Of Origin | China |

| Storage | ABS YOUHER1385P should be stored in a cool, dry, and well-ventilated area, away from direct sunlight and sources of heat or ignition. Keep the material in tightly sealed, original containers to prevent contamination. Avoid exposure to moisture and chemicals that could degrade its quality. Ensure the storage location is secure, clearly labeled, and complies with relevant safety regulations for plastics. |
| Shelf Life | The shelf life of ABS YOUHER1385P is typically 1 year when stored in cool, dry conditions in original, unopened packaging. |

Comparing grades reveals real differences in function, not just in specs. Commodity ABS works for some simple parts, but once things move to assemblies with snap fits or where appearance matters, those grades let manufacturers down with visible sink marks or joint failures. High-impact or flame-retardant grades bring their own trade-offs, like higher cost or tougher drying requirements. YOUHER1385P serves as a general-purpose tough grade that works for thin sections and moderate impact demands, without large cost jumps or the headaches of specialty additives.
